Help with States

Hey Guys,

I recently installed WinUAE to play Dungeon Master, all went well and I was able to complete the first few levels using load and save states to save my progress, however just recently they have stopped working.

When I try to load my newest state I get a CPU trace: Get 00202286 1 2 NOT FOUND! error, and then I get a Software Failure and the game resets... If I go back to a save about half an hour earlier in the game then all will work fine but then within half an hour this error will rear it's ugly head again... I find even doing something such as picking up a club and saving will prevent me loading that save again.

I'm not sure what I have done wrong, do any of you guys have any ideas?

I found something, full 68020 CE state support isn't yet done (full as in CPU in mid instruction is saved 100% exactly), I guess I forgot.. (68000 is complete)

Quick workaround should be as simple as to disable cycle exact when saving the state. (Dungeon Master probably does not even need CE)
